Richard John Howell was an American competition swimmer who represented the United States at the 1924 Summer Olympics in Paris. As a 20-year-old at the 1924 Olympics, he swam for the gold-medal-winning American relay team in the men's 4×200-meter freestyle relay. After swimming in the preliminary heats and semifinals and helping the American relay team qualify for the final, he was replaced by Johnny Weissmuller. In the semifinals he was a member of the team that set a new world record of 9:59.4
